Digital Gaming Corporation has expanded its footprint in New Jersey, with Resorts Digital Gaming incorporating the provider’s whole portfolio of online slot content.

The deal would provide New Jersey-based operator’s customers’ access to various igaming titles, including the 9 Masks of Fire and HyperStrike games, which DGC claims are “already popular with Garden State players.” Assassin Moon, HyperGold, and Adventures of Doubloon Island are included.

While DGC’s games will initially begin in New Jersey, the contract is multi-state in nature. It will be expanded to include any newly regulated jurisdictions into which the operator expands. Earlier this month, it was revealed that New Jersey’s online casinos and poker rooms completed the year with a record $133.2 million in revenue, surpassing the previous year’s record of $127 million in October 2021. This was also 25.3% from $99.5 million in December 2020.

Borgata maintained its lead with $37 million, up 36.4 percent from $27.1 million, but Golden Nugget Online Gaming closed the gap to one million dollars with $36 million. Resorts Digital rounded out the top three with $32.9 million.

“In Resorts Digital Gaming, we have a partner who understands the critical nature of providing players with premium and diversified content that satisfies their desire for high levels of engagement and pleasure,” said Neill Whyte, the chief commercial officer of DGC’s B2B igaming division.

“Our games accomplish precisely that, having been developed specifically for the US market. They are now some of the most played slots in the Garden State, and we look forward to watching Resorts Casino players enjoy their unmatched experience.”

Ed Andrewes, CEO of Resorts Digital Gaming, added: “Resorts Casino has already established a sizable market position in the New Jersey online slot market, owing in part to the industry-leading game library we have curated. By incorporating DGC’s based, premium games, we can take this to the next level.

“DGC’s commitment to the US market is apparent in the success of its slots among players in New Jersey and elsewhere, and we are happy to be able to provide its content to our players for the first time, who we believe will enjoy the excitement and thrills each title brings.
